From cb3ed6ed718d4a68eda49945cbff223aaf730dad Mon Sep 17 00:00:00 2001 From: Tobias Henkel Date: Fri, 17 Jan 2020 13:00:06 +0100 Subject: [PATCH] Don't expand change panel on middle click When middle clicking on the link to the change a user typically doesn't want the item to expand/contract. Instead it should not react on this event. Change-Id: I663732887d0b7b6e13fe38da555e5a092d49f05f Story: 2005895 Task: 33754 --- web/src/containers/status/ChangePanel.jsx |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/web/src/containers/status/ChangePanel.jsx b/web/src/containers/status/ChangePanel.jsx index a3a9f4cf27..d19072608e 100644 --- a/web/src/containers/status/ChangePanel.jsx +++ b/web/src/containers/status/ChangePanel.jsx @@ -34,7 +34,11 @@ class ChangePanel extends React.Component { this.clicked = false } - onClick () { + onClick (e) { + // Skip middle mouse button + if (e.button === 1) { + return + } let expanded = this.state.expanded if (!this.clicked) { expanded = this.props.globalExpanded